MUMBAI, India, Oct. 11 -- Intellectual Property India has published a patent application (202518091627 A) filed by Lg Energy Solution, Ltd., Seoul, Republic of Korea, on Sept. 24, for 'electrode assembly, battery, and battery pack and vehicle comprising same.'

Inventor(s) include Lim, Hae-Jin; Kong, Jin-Hak; Lee, Soon-O; Choi, Kyu-Hyun; Kim, Do-Gyun; Choi, Su-Ji; Hwangbo, Kwang-Su; Min, Geon-Woo; Jo, Min-Ki; Lim, Jae-Won; Kim, Hak-Kyun; Lee, Je-Jun; Jung, Ji-Min; Kim, Jae-Woong; Park, Jong-Sik; Choe, Yu-Sung; Lee, Byoung-Gu; Ryu, Duk-Hyun; Lee, Kwan-Hee; Lee, Jae-Eun; Kang, Bo-Hyun; and Park, Pil-Kyu.

The application for the patent was published on Oct. 10, under issue no. 41/2025.

According to the abstract released by the Intellectual Property India: "Disclosed is an electrode assembly, a battery, and a battery pack and a vehicle 5 including the same. In the electrode assembly, a first electrode, a second electrode, and a separator interposed therebetween are wound based on an axis to define a core and an outer circumference. The first electrode includes an uncoated portion at a long side end thereof and exposed out of the separator along a winding axis direction of the electrode assembly. A part of the uncoated portion is bent in a radial direction of the electrode assembly to 10 form a bending surface region that includes overlapping layers of the uncoated portion, and in a partial region of the bending surface region, the number of stacked layers of the uncoated portion is 10 or more in the winding axis direction of the electrode assembly."

The patent application was internationally filed on Jan. 19, 2022, under International application No.PCT/KR2022/001010.
